Impact of Three-dimensional Visualization on Operation Strategy and Complications for Pancreatic Cancer

Brief Summary
The aim of the multi-centre study is to evaluate correctly the impact of three dimensional visualization on operation strategy and complications for Pancreatic Cancer.

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- 18 years≤ Age ≤70 years 2.Compling with the diagnosis criteria of Pancreatic Cancer. 3.Primary Pancreatic Cancer without metastasis. 4.The patients are volunteered for the study.
Exclusion
- Patients with mental illness.
- Patients can't tolerate the operation owe to a variety of basic diseases (such as severe cardiopulmonary insufficiency, renal insufficiency, cachexia and blood system diseases, etc.)
- The patients refused to take part in the study.
- There are other co-existed malignant tumors.
